N54 DME/CAS/KOMBI/key set plug and play?

Hi, recently picked up a 2010 n54 off a trade from another vehicle as a bonus.

Was told the engine was swapped to an 80k mile one and the car has 150k body miles, Didn't realize that the DME or CAS was swapped out too, the previous owner said it was so he could run an mhd tune properly? That doesn't seem right to me unless he bricked something and needed to change it (but I'm no expert), currently, steering buttons don't work along with Christmas lights on the dash, and the odometer shows 270k that he says is in km with tamper dot. Old owner said since the battery was disconnected it reset everything and is now showing the donor DME or CAS mileage and all I need to do is flash his "custom tune" to get everything set to the original 150k body mileage. The mhd tune that he wants me to flash is tied a different vin too, Car also has 2 keys that he says is because of this.

Honestly, would rather not run a custom tune that I have no idea where it came from or fix everything he's done. Could I just get a full set of DME/CAS/KOMBI/key and use that instead, coding it to the vin to get it all working right? Keep in mind not looking to roll back the odometer, just get it back to the original 150k (If possible) and have everything communicating w/ each other.
